首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Apache camel在多个节点上运行

Apache Camel是一个开源的集成框架,用于在不同的应用程序之间进行消息传递和数据交换。它提供了丰富的组件和工具,使开发人员能够轻松地构建和管理各种集成模式和路由。

Apache Camel的优势包括:

  1. 灵活性:Apache Camel支持多种通信协议和数据格式,可以与各种系统和应用程序进行集成,包括数据库、消息队列、Web服务等。
  2. 可扩展性:Apache Camel提供了丰富的组件和工具,可以轻松地扩展和定制集成解决方案,满足不同业务需求。
  3. 可靠性:Apache Camel具有强大的错误处理和故障恢复机制,可以确保消息的可靠传递和处理。
  4. 易用性:Apache Camel提供了简单易用的DSL(领域特定语言),使开发人员能够以声明性的方式定义路由和转换规则,减少了开发工作量。

Apache Camel的应用场景包括:

  1. 企业集成:Apache Camel可以用于构建企业级的集成解决方案,将不同的系统和应用程序进行无缝集成,实现数据的传递和转换。
  2. 消息传递:Apache Camel可以用于构建消息传递系统,实现异步消息的发送和接收,支持多种消息协议和格式。
  3. 数据转换:Apache Camel可以用于数据的格式转换和映射,将不同的数据源进行统一处理和管理。
  4. 事件驱动:Apache Camel可以用于构建事件驱动的应用程序,实现事件的发布和订阅,支持多种事件处理模式。

对于在多个节点上运行Apache Camel,可以使用Apache Karaf作为运行环境。Apache Karaf是一个轻量级的容器,可以在多个节点上部署和管理Apache Camel应用程序。通过Apache Karaf,可以实现Apache Camel应用程序的集群部署和负载均衡,提高系统的可靠性和性能。

腾讯云提供了云原生应用平台TKE(Tencent Kubernetes Engine),可以用于部署和管理Apache Camel应用程序。TKE提供了强大的容器编排和管理功能,可以实现Apache Camel应用程序的自动化部署、扩缩容和监控管理。您可以通过TKE来部署和管理Apache Camel应用程序,提高系统的可靠性和可扩展性。

更多关于Apache Camel的信息和腾讯云相关产品,请参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分18秒

104_尚硅谷_MapReduce_WordCount案例在集群上运行.avi

7分16秒

142-微服务案例-部署运行-微服务打包-在总体聚合工程上执行 install_ev

53秒

ARM版IDEA运行在M1芯片上到底有多快?

2分21秒

Parallels Desktop 17 安装Windows 10 完整视频教程

4分43秒

SuperEdge易学易用系列-使用ServiceGroup实现多地域应用管理

10分11秒

10分钟学会在Linux/macOS上配置JDK,并使用jenv优雅地切换JDK版本。兼顾娱乐和生产

2分25秒

ICRA 2021|VOLDOR实时稠密非直接法SLAM系统

16分8秒

Tspider分库分表的部署 - MySQL

37分59秒

腾讯云智慧地产云端系列讲堂丨第四期:腾讯零信任iOA助力地产行业数字化转型、降本增效

1.2K
-

529亿美元买了频谱!Verizon未来3年625亿资本开支将从何而来?

10分0秒

如何云上远程调试Nginx源码?

1分42秒

智慧监狱视频智能分析系统

领券